How To Fix /PMG/ABP_CMDIFF_MSG005 - Commission posting text only allowed for activated pending comm. case


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/PMG/ABP_CMDIFF_MSG -

  • Message number: 005

  • Message text: Commission posting text only allowed for activated pending comm. case

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/PMG/ABP_CMDIFF_MSG005 - Commission posting text only allowed for activated pending comm. case ?

    The SAP error message /PMG/ABP_CMDIFF_MSG005 indicates that there is an issue with the commission posting text in the context of a pending commission case. This error typically arises when you attempt to post a commission with a text that is not allowed because the pending commission case has not been activated.

    Cause:

    1. Pending Commission Case Not Activated: The primary cause of this error is that the commission case you are trying to post to is still in a pending state and has not been activated. In SAP, only activated commission cases allow for certain types of postings, including those with specific text entries.
    2. Incorrect Configuration: There may be configuration settings in the commission management module that restrict the use of text in postings for pending cases.
    3. Data Entry Error: There might be an issue with the data being entered, such as incorrect formatting or invalid characters in the commission posting text.

    Solution:

    1. Activate the Pending Commission Case:

      • Navigate to the commission case in question and check its status. If it is still pending, you will need to activate it. This can usually be done through the relevant transaction code or menu path in SAP.
      • Ensure that all necessary prerequisites for activation are met.
    2. Review Configuration Settings:

      • Check the configuration settings for commission management in your SAP system. Ensure that the settings allow for text entries in commission postings for activated cases.
      • Consult with your SAP administrator or functional consultant to verify that the configuration aligns with your business requirements.
    3. Correct Data Entry:

      • Review the text you are trying to enter in the commission posting. Ensure that it adheres to any formatting rules or restrictions that may be in place.
      • If necessary, simplify the text or remove any special characters that may be causing the issue.
    4. Consult Documentation:

      •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for more detailed information on commission management and the specific error message. This can provide insights into any additional steps or considerations.
